Texas-based LNG company Excelerate Energy Inc. announced Feb. 23 a quarterly cash dividend, with respect to the quarter ended Dec. 31, 2023, of $.025 per share of Class A common stock.
The dividend is payable March 28 to Class A common stockholders of record by March 13.
Excelerate Energy Ltd. Partnership, Excelerate Energy’s subsidiary, will also make a corresponding distribution of $.025 per interest to holders of its Class B limited partnership interests on the same date of the dividend payment.
